Output ec8d1c1da5a8621f79c46563237b19aa88a138c7e5ad515ef757080bd4bfae58:2

value
995637
script pubkey
OP_0 OP_PUSHBYTES_20 f51e4e0bc1aa4c6e8d61762a6f7a51be03da09fe
address
ltc1q750yuz7p4fxxartpwc4x77j3hcpa5z07ukf6xm
transaction
ec8d1c1da5a8621f79c46563237b19aa88a138c7e5ad515ef757080bd4bfae58
spent
true